== Disadvantages == Metasearch engines are not capable of [[parsing]] query forms or able to fully translate query [[Syntax (logic)|syntax]]. The number of [[hyperlink]]s generated by metasearch engines are limited, and therefore do not provide the user with the complete results of a query.<ref>{{cite web | url=https://www3.unifr.ch/inf/en/ | title=Department of Informatics | publisher=[[University of Fribourg]]}}</ref> The majority of metasearch engines do not provide over ten linked files from a single search engine, and generally do not interact with larger search engines for results. [[Pay per click]] links are prioritised and are normally displayed first.<ref>{{cite web | url=http://nsarchive.gwu.edu/NSAEBB/NSAEBB436/docs/EBB-005.pdf | title=Intelligence Exploitation of the Internet | year=2002}}</ref> Metasearching also gives the illusion that there is more coverage of the topic queried, particularly if the user is searching for popular or commonplace information. It's common to end with multiple identical results from the queried engines. It is also harder for users to search with advanced search syntax to be sent with the query, so results may not be as precise as when a user is using an advanced search interface at a specific engine. This results in many metasearch engines using simple searching.<ref name="Hennegar2009">{{cite web | url=https://www.timeatlas.com/metasearch-engines-expands-your-horizon/ | title=Metasearch Engines Expands your Horizon | first=Anne | last=Hennegar| date=16 September 2009 }}</ref>
